Wend II Inc. is a left-of-center grantmaking organization run by James M. Walton, the cousin of Ben Walton, the grandson of Walmart founder Sam Walton, and Sam Walton. 1 2 3 Wend II supports left-of-center and critical race theory-influenced social policy organizations. 4

Wend II Inc. distributes  grants to left-of-center organizations including Equal Justice Initiative,  Beyond Conflict, Institute for the Study of Energy and Our Future, New Venture Fund,  Social Good Fund, Seattle Foundation, 5 Greenlining Institute, Wildflower Foundation, Beyond Conflict, Peace Development Fund, and  Equal Justice Initiative. 6

History and Leadership

Wend II Inc. was launched in 2017 with a gift of $69,903,775 of Walmart stock. 7 8 In 2018, Wend II Inc. received tax-exempt status from the Internal Revenue Service. 9

James Walton is the executive director of Wend II Inc. 10  The organization is headquartered in Bentonville, Arkansas. 11

Activities

Wend II Inc. is a grantmaking foundation that has supported left-of-center and critical race theory-influenced social policy organizations since its launch. 12 By 2019, Wend II’s grantmaking was primarily structured as general support grants, with a focus on Denver, Colorado-based and left-of-center organizations. 13

Wend II is a part of the broader Wend Collective, which includes an impact investment fund focused on left-of-center policy initiatives; critical race theory-influenced social justice and climate organizations; and Native American, civic, and environmentalist issues. According to a 2021 report from Inside Philanthropy, Wend Collective has 24 employees, including former staff of former U.S. Senator Mark Udall (D-CO), then-Governor John Hickenlooper (D-CO), and the Walton Family Foundation. Inside Philanthropy characterized Wend II as the “least buttoned-down” of Walton family-related philanthropies. 14

Grantmaking

Wend II Inc. is primarily a grantmaking organization. It has funded projects in Providence, Rhode Island; Austin, Texas;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ania; New Orleans, Louisiana; and Denver, Colorado. Wend II has also given grants to individual Montessori Schools, Native American groups, and several Colorado-based organizations. 15

In 2022, Wend II Inc. made $42,426,000 in grants. Funding

Wend II Inc. receives its funding from contributions, gifts, and grants; returns on endowed funds; and sale of Walmart stock. 18 In 2022, Wend II Inc. reported revenue of $31,078,960 and expenses of $45,891,517. 19 The organization reported revenue of $207,303,582 and expenses of $40,016,201 in 2021. 20

A large portion of Wend II’s funding comes directly from its executive director, James Walton. Walton gave Wend II Inc. $28,652,865 in 2022 21 and $210,835,685 in 2021. 22 He also lent Wend II Inc. at least $5 million in 2021. 23
